Details
Diameter: 36mm, thickness: 3mm
Front:
Token with a stippled zigzag border, and two concentric circles of stippled text around the date in the middle:
AGED 24 : 12 . MONTHS X
CITY : GOAL X
1849
Back:
Token with a stippled zigzag border and the central image of a cup with two crossed pipes below it. Around the image runs the stippled text:
CHARLES : BETTS X

Hiya, this token can be attributed to Charles Betts, an English sheep thief who served 12 months in 1849. See: Norfolk News, 24 March 1849 and Bury and Norwich Post, 28 March 1849.
